ooops forgot to actually write something? um, yesterday i bought 2 clown loaches, when i put them into the tank they were fine, today when i looked at them they were burried in the gravel, when they came out for food they were fine then after that they wedged themselves in a small gap between a rock and the glass. is that normal or are they unhappy?? can anyone help me please?

I've never had clown loaches, but do have yo yo loaches. I think your clowns are just looking for hiding places. My yo yo's are constantly popping out of nowhere. The more hiding places you have for them, the more you will see them because they feel secure.

just went onto a website for clown loaches. apparentley they like alot of hiding places, and unfortunately we havent got many, they advise pipes or bamboo, they like the shade, awy from the aquarium lights. they are also better in groups and not just 1 of them in a tank with others. they are middle to bottom dwellers. also they like being in a tank with other peaceful fish, and another reason why they could be hiding is if they are being bullied, i dont think thats the case in my tank, infact im sure it isnt.

My clown loaches like to squeeze into the smallest places they can find. They will even snuggle up together. They are wonderful fish and will take a little bit to acclimate to the tank.
